Some of my clients worry that starting down the path of employee engagement will be expensive - giving out awards, hiring an HR professional, creating a budget. This recent Forbes article talks about how to do it on a shoestring budget. One of the shoestring tactics they mention is my favorite one to talk about in my workshops on employee engagement and retention - giving praise. Doesn't cost a dime - but most companies so poorly use it that it's bordering on a worthless tactic. You might consider training your management team how to be better at showing empathy, gratitude, appreciation, and being thankful for the work your employees do daily.
